Mango-lemon ice cream (helado de mango y limón)



Some days ago a friend of my husband gave him some mangos. They were small but very aromatic. We ate some of them these days but now they´re ripening very quickly and I decided to make something with them before they spoil. I surf the Internet and I found this recipe in one of my favorites cuisine blogs: "Directo al paladar". The original one is made with mango, lime and mint but I didn´t have lime and mint so I decided to make it with lemon and spearmint. It´s also delicious.


Ingredients:


1 Big ripen mango or 2 small mangos
50g of Powdered sugar
50g of Glucose
500g of Natural yogurt (without sugar or fruits)
The juice of 1 big lime/lemon or 2 small limes/lemons
1 Spoon of chopped mint/spearmint leaves.


Peel the mango and cut it in pieces. Put the mango, the mint leaves, the sugar, the glucose, the yogurt and the lime/lemon juice in a food processor . Blend it until you get a thin cream. Next, pour the cream in the ice cream maker machine and follow the maker indications to make ice cream( different ice cream makers, different indications).

* The glucose makes it smooth and helps control the formation of sugar crystals . If you don´t have any glucose you can replace it for honey, corn syrup or make this mix:
1 Kilo of sugar
300 ml of Fresh water
5g of Lemon juice
5g of Bicarbonate of soda


Heat the water, the sugar and the lemon juice. When it boils, apart it from the fire and wait until it cools to 50º C (122ºF) and add the bicarbonate. Take 50 g and keep the rest for another ice creams.( very recommended.. mmmm)
